ST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ID DESCRIPTION:
CAFFEINE TABLETS - ORAL (kaff-EEN)

COMMON ST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ID BRAND NAME(S):
Alert, No Doz, Stay Awake, Vivarin

ST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ID SIDE EFFECTS:
Nausea, stomach upset, insomnia, restlessness, nervousness, tremor, headache, lightheadedness may occur. Large amounts of caffeine may aggravate ulcers, cause frequent urination, flushing, muscle twitch or irritability. If any of these effects continue or become bothersome, inform your doctor. Notify your doctor if you experience: dizziness, depression, rapid breathing, chest pain, confusion, fatigue. Abrupt stopping of caffeine intake after several weeks of regular daily use may cause withdrawal symptoms such as headache, anxiety or muscle tension within 12 to 18 hours.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act your doctor or pharmacist.

ST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ID USES:
Caffeine is a stimulant that is used to help keep you awake and alert. It is also used for certain types of headaches.

ST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ID PRECAUTIONS:
Tell your doctor if you have: heart disease, diabetes, anxiety disorders, depression, ulcers, allergies. ST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ID is not recommended for use during pregnancy. Discuss the risks and benefits with your doctor. Since small amounts of ST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ID appear in breast milk, consult your doctor before breast-feeding.

ST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ID DRUG INTERACTIONS:
Tell your doctor of any over-the-counter or prescription medication you may take, including: cimetidine, disulfiram, ciprofloxacin, enoxacin, birth control pills, diet pills, decongestants, if you smoke. Do not start or stop any medicine without doctor or pharmacist approval.

ST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ID OVERDOSE:
If overdose is suspected, contact your local poison control center or emergency room immediately. Symptoms of overdose may include stomach pain, anxiety, agitation, confusion, irregular or fast heartbeat, frequent urination, muscle twitching, ringing in the ears, trouble sleeping, and seizures.

ST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ID NOTES:
STAY AWAKE ALERTNESS AID is not a substitute for normal sleep patterns. It is not to be taken on a routine basis. Be aware of the caffeine content in foods and beverages such as coffee, tea, soft drinks, cocoa and chocolate.
